码迷,mamicode.com
首页 >  
搜索关键字:kahadb    ( 33个结果
ActiveMQ--消息存储和持久化
官网(这里的持久化和前面说的消息持久化是不同的,前面的消息持久化,事务签收都是说的MQ服务器本机,而这里的持久化说的是与本机相连的数据库的数据持久化,包括:kahadb,JDBC等) 为了保证高可用,消息不仅在本机MQ存储(持久化)一份,还要再数据库中持久化一份来保证高可用。 http://acti ...
分类:其他好文   时间:2021-06-02 16:28:07    阅读次数:0
如何避免activeMQ数据丢失
做消息持久化 借助 jdbc, kahadb或 leveldb+zookeeper首先将将消息发送设置为持久化发送(mq自带的属性),然后再借助jdbc kahadb leveldb+zookeeper等做消息的存储来持久化。思想都是发送者(消息生产者)将消息发送出去后,消息中心首先将消息存储到本地 ...
分类:其他好文   时间:2020-04-10 22:48:34    阅读次数:232
深入理解RocketMQ(四)--消息存储
一、MQ存储分类 文件系统:RocketMQ/Kafka/RabbitMQ 关系型数据库DB:ActiveMQ(默认采用的KahaDB做消息存储)可选用JDBC的方式来做消息持久化 分布式KV存储:ZeroMQ 对比: 存储效率, 文件系统>分布式KV存储>关系型数据库DB 易于实现和快速集成,关系 ...
分类:其他好文   时间:2020-03-22 13:59:27    阅读次数:184
ActiveMQ的学习(二)(ActiveMQ的持久化)
消息持久化 消息持久化是保证消息不丢失的重要方式。 ActiveMQ提供了以下三种的消息存储方式: 1. Memory消息存储-基于内存的消息存储。 2. 基于日志消息存储方式,KahaDB是ActiveMQ的默认日志存储方式,它提供了容量的提升和恢复能力。 3. 基于JDBC的消息存储方式-数据存 ...
分类:其他好文   时间:2020-02-15 15:08:30    阅读次数:67
ActiveMQ 消息存储持久化
ActiveMQ中对于投递模式设置为持久化的消息, 接收到到消息之后,会 ,然后 ActiveMQ持久化方式:AMQ、KahaDB、JDBC、LevelDB 持久化配置路径: "官方文档: http://activemq.apache.org/persistence.html" Message保存方 ...
分类:其他好文   时间:2019-08-25 16:23:26    阅读次数:352
ActiveMQ(七)——ActiveMQ的Network
一、在一台服务器上启动多个Broker步骤如下(为集群做准备):1:把整个conf文件夹复制一份,比如叫做conf22:修改里面的activemq.xml文件(1)里面的brokerName不能跟原来的重复(2)数据存放的文件名称不能重复,比如:<hahaDBdirectory=”${activemq.data}/kahadb_2”/>(3)所有设计的transportConnecto
分类:Web程序   时间:2019-06-30 23:16:14    阅读次数:260
学习ActiveMQ(八):activemq的持久化
1. 持久化方式介绍前面我们也简单提到了activemq提供的插件式的消息存储,在这里再提一下,主要有以下几种方式: AMQ消息存储-基于文件的存储方式,是activemq开始的版本默认的消息存储方式;KahaDB消息存储-提供了容量的提升和恢复能力,是现在的默认存储方式;JDBC消息存储-消息基于 ...
分类:其他好文   时间:2019-04-27 13:23:27    阅读次数:132
activemq的高级特性:消息存储持久化
消息存储持久化机制 有基于文件的,数据库的,内存的。默认的是基于文件的,在安装目录/data/kahadb。在conf/activemq.xml文件中。 <persistenceAdapter> <kahaDB directory="${activemq.data}/kahadb"/> </pers ...
分类:其他好文   时间:2019-04-01 18:54:02    阅读次数:217
2019第3周日-回顾
ActiveMQ常用的三种持久化存储方案:KahaDB、LevelDB、关系型数据库。其中KahaDB和LevelDB的工作原理基本类似,都采用内存+磁盘介质的方案:内存用于存放信息的位置索引,磁盘介质上存放消息内容。而关系型数据库的方案,ActiveMQ将完全通过JDBC对数据库进行操作完成消息的 ...
分类:其他好文   时间:2019-01-20 10:25:01    阅读次数:156
ActiveMQ 填坑记
Mysql持久化现在大家使用MQ,基本都是会把数据进行持久化,MQ默认存储持久化数据使用kahaDB,但是鉴于大家对mysql比较熟悉,很多人会选择mysql进行数据的持久化,因为mysql查看数据还是比较方便的。如果需要把持久化方式改为mysql,则需要修改如下配置:<persistenceAdapter><jdbcPersistenceAdapterdataDirectory
分类:其他好文   时间:2018-12-26 13:59:42    阅读次数:132
33条   1 2 3 4 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!